10 topics appearing the most in IELTS Speaking Part 1

Here are four questions and answers for each of the 10 common topics for IELTS Speaking Part 1:

1. Work or studies:

  • What do you do for work/study?
    “I am currently a student, studying computer science at the university.”
  • What did you study in school?
    “I studied a variety of subjects in school, but my main focus was on math and science.”
  • Do you like your job/study?
    “I really enjoy studying computer science. I find it challenging, but also very rewarding.”
  • What are your plans for the future?
    “My plan is to find a job in the tech industry after I graduate, and eventually work my way up to a management position.”

2. Hobbies and interests:

  • What do you like to do in your free time?
    “I enjoy reading, hiking, and playing video games in my free time.”
  • How often do you engage in your hobbies?
    “I try to make time for my hobbies at least a few times a week.”
  • Why do you like these activities?
    “I like these activities because they allow me to relax and escape from the stress of daily life.”
  • Do you think hobbies are important?
    “I definitely think hobbies are important. They provide a sense of balance and fulfillment in life.”

3. Home and living:

  • Where are you from?
    “I am originally from a small town in the countryside.”
  • Where do you live now?
    “I currently live in the city for my studies.”
  • Do you prefer city or countryside living?
    “I prefer the countryside, as it is quieter and has more greenery, but I appreciate the convenience and excitement of city living as well.”
  • What kind of housing do you live in?
    “I live in a small apartment in the city, which is convenient for my studies and budget.”

4. Travel:

  • Have you traveled to any countries?
    “Yes, I have traveled to several countries, including Japan, Italy, and Australia.”
  • Where would you like to travel to in the future?
    “I would love to visit New Zealand in the future, as it is known for its stunning landscapes and outdoor activities.”
  • Why do you like to travel?
    “I like to travel because it allows me to experience new cultures, try new foods, and make new memories.”
  • Do you think travel is important?
    “I definitely think travel is important, as it broadens your horizons and helps you appreciate different perspectives and ways of life.”

5. Family and friends:

  • Who do you live with?
    “I currently live alone, but I have a close-knit family who live nearby.”
  • How important are friends and family to you?
    “Friends and family are incredibly important to me. They provide support, love, and laughter in my life.”
  • Do you have any close friends?
    “Yes, I have a small group of close friends who I have known for many years.”
  • Do you think family and friends are more important than work or hobbies?
    “For me, family and friends are equally important as work and hobbies. They all play a role in my overall happiness and well-being.”

6. Health and fitness:

  • How do you stay healthy?
    “I stay healthy by eating a balanced diet and exercising regularly, such as going to the gym or playing sports.”
  • How often do you exercise?
    “I try to exercise at least 3-4 times a week.”
  • Do you eat healthy food?
    “I try to eat healthy food, but I also allow myself the occasional treat, such as junk food or dessert.”
  • What is your opinion on healthy living?
    “I think healthy living is very important, as it impacts not only your physical health, but also your mental and emotional well-being.”

7. Technology:

  • What kind of technology do you use?
    “I use a variety of technology, including a smartphone, laptop, and smart home devices.”
  • How often do you use technology?
    “I use technology on a daily basis, both for personal and work-related purposes.”
  • Do you think technology has improved our lives?
    “I definitely think technology has improved our lives in many ways, such as by making communication and information access easier and more convenient.”
  • What is your opinion on the impact of technology on society?
    “I believe that technology has both positive and negative impacts on society, such as increasing efficiency and convenience, but also leading to decreased face-to-face interaction and increased screen time.”

8. Weather and climate:

  • What is the weather like where you live?
    “The weather where I live is typically mild, with temperatures ranging from the low 60s to the high 80s.”
  • Do you like hot or cold weather more?
    “I personally prefer warm weather, as it allows for more outdoor activities and a more positive mood.”
  • What is your favorite season?
    “My favorite season is summer, as it provides more opportunities for vacations and outdoor activities.”
  • What is your opinion on climate change?
    “I believe that climate change is a serious issue that needs to be addressed, as it will have far-reaching impacts on our environment and way of life.”

9. Food and drink:

  • What kind of food do you like to eat?
    “I enjoy a variety of food, but I particularly like Mexican and Italian cuisine.”
  • Do you like to cook?
    “Yes, I enjoy cooking, as it allows me to experiment with different ingredients and flavors.”
  • What is your favorite food?
    “My favorite food is sushi, as it is a combination of fresh ingredients and unique flavors.”
  • What is your opinion on healthy eating?
